Fixed flushing of caches with parameters
authorMagnus Kühn <magnus.khn@gmail.com>
Sun, 10 Feb 2013 17:44:16 +0000 (18:44 +0100)
committerMagnus Kühn <magnus.khn@gmail.com>
Sun, 10 Feb 2013 17:44:16 +0000 (18:44 +0100)
wcfsetup/install/files/lib/system/cache/CacheHandler.class.php

index 9b9ebf5c2590bc9a11d7de8b9aee9f96771de2b1..a1c5630953fbea1d19c5c081ebff3c91229bb742 100644 (file)
@@ -50,7 +50,7 @@ class CacheHandler extends SingletonFactory {
         * @param       array                                           $parameters
         */
        public function flush(ICacheBuilder $cacheBuilder, array $parameters) {
-               $useWildCard = (empty($parameters)) ? false : true;
+               $useWildCard = (empty($parameters)) ? true : false;
                $this->getCacheSource()->flush($this->getCacheName($cacheBuilder), $useWildCard);
        }